The Versatility of Chicken Wire A Practical Guide


Chicken wire, a mesh made of thin, flexible galvanized steel, is an often-overlooked material with a myriad of applications beyond its original purpose of confining chickens. This peculiar wire mesh has gained popularity in various fields, including gardening, home improvement, crafts, and even art. In this article, we will explore the versatility of chicken wire, its advantages, and some creative ways to utilize it.


To begin with, chicken wire’s primary purpose is to provide a safe enclosure for poultry. Its distinctive hexagonal openings allow airflow and sunlight to reach the birds while keeping predators at bay. However, the benefits of chicken wire extend well beyond the poultry pen. Gardeners have found it to be an invaluable tool for protecting plants from unwanted pests. By constructing a barrier with chicken wire, gardeners can deter rabbits, deer, and other animals from feasting on their fruits and vegetables. Additionally, using chicken wire to create trellises for climbing plants can help maximize space and promote healthy growth.

In home improvement projects, chicken wire has made its mark as an eco-friendly and cost-effective solution. For instance, it can be used to reinforce plaster walls, allowing for a stronger finish while minimizing the risk of cracking. Additionally, some homeowners have taken a creative approach by using chicken wire to create decorative elements in their living spaces. For example, a chicken wire frame can serve as a unique bulletin board, where photos, notes, and artwork can be displayed in an appealing and organized manner.

Craft enthusiasts have also embraced chicken wire, incorporating it into a wide range of DIY projects. Its rustic appearance lends itself well to farmhouse-style decor. With a little creativity and effort, one can transform chicken wire into beautiful wall art, unique light fixtures, or even stylish storage solutions. A popular project is creating a chicken wire wreath, which can be embellished with seasonal decorations such as flowers, leaves, or ornaments.


In the realm of art, chicken wire has gained attention for its unique textural qualities. Artists have begun to use chicken wire to create sculptures and installations that explore themes of transparency, fragility, and resilience. The unconventional nature of the material allows for the exploration of juxtaposed concepts such as strength and vulnerability. By manipulating chicken wire, artists can engage viewers in a dialogue about the perception of materials and their intrinsic properties.


Environmental sustainability is another reason for the increasing popularity of chicken wire. As more people become aware of the importance of reducing waste, chicken wire’s long-lasting durability makes it an attractive option for various applications. Repurposing old chicken wire into new projects not only reduces waste but also encourages creativity and resourcefulness.
